Job Description:

Are you ready to take your career to new heights?

  • Location: Natwest/Ulster Bank, Belfast City Centre - office-based training and grad bay (7 weeks). Hybrid work after training. Great public transport links!
  • Shifts: Full time, 40 hours/week, between 07:00 and 01:00
  • Training Duration: 3 weeks onsite training, 4 weeks grad bay onsite
  • Probity Requirements: Credit, Criminal, Sanctions, and Fraud checks; last 2 years employment history and last 5 years address history required

Job Overview
Provide proactive and reactive customer service to ensure clients meet their financial goals and arrangements.

Key Responsibilities
Serve as the first point of contact, delivering outstanding customer service, educating clients on banking options, and completing processes accurately and compliantly to ensure positive experiences.

Take appropriate actions to ensure good customer outcomes, review interactions regularly, and address gaps proactively.

Role as Customer Service Advisor

  • Deliver excellent service, focusing on customer needs and financial goals
  • Educate clients on banking methods and assist in choosing suitable options
  • Complete processes meticulously for seamless customer experiences

Additional Responsibilities

  • Conduct financial reviews, provide accurate information for informed decision-making
  • Manage your diary, balance proactive and scheduled customer interactions
  • Support the bank’s operations, maintain relationships, resolve complaints swiftly, and ensure customer satisfaction

Required Skills

  • Experience in customer service and relationship management
  • Strong organizational and time management skills
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ills
  • Experience in a regulatory environment
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office
  • Customer-focused attitude
